Understanding Core Infrastructure in DeFi

In traditional finance, infrastructure refers to systems that other services rely on to function. In DeFi, this role is filled by protocols that provide shared liquidity, composability, and trustless execution.

Core infrastructure in DeFi typically includes:

  • Decentralized exchanges

  • Lending and borrowing protocols

  • Oracles and data layers

  • Settlement and routing mechanisms

Without these components, ecosystems struggle to attract users or sustain economic activity.
